About The Position

We’re seeking a Senior Interior Designer to join our project team for the design of a confidential integrated resort —a landmark destination envisioned to redefine the relationship between architecture, landscape, and experience. Spanning over one million square feet , the project will blend casino, food and beverage, and hotel environments with over 75,000 square feet of special venue space , including an award-winning steakhouse, a rooftop bar, a collection of one-of-a-kind lounges and entertainment venues, and a world-class spa . The resort will also feature a championship golf course that connects the built environment to its natural setting in a seamless and dramatic way. The guest tower celebrates 500 guest rooms , culminating in a range of scale and luxury experiences, highlighted by the sky suites, offering panoramic views and elevated private experiences. This project embodies the ambition to create a destination that is immersive, contemporary, and unforgettable in every detail.
